Route 101 Closed Due To Rollover
Update: Alerts online are reporting that the eastbound side of the roadway has been reopened.

EXETER, NH — Route 101 in Exeter was partially closed due to a serious motor vehicle accident this morning, according to alerts online. A rollover was reported at around 6:30 a.m. on Oct. 18, 2017, according to Exeter Police on Twitter. Both eastbound lanes between Exits 10 and 11 are closed.

At around 7:15 a.m., one eastbound lane reopened, according to the NH DOT on Twitter. Thirty minutes later, the roadway was opened again.
